The reality is that the platform offers its subscribers a well-stocked mobile game library. In it we will not only find a lot to choose from, but we will also see how new titles are constantly added.
Netflix Spain opened its mobile games section at the end of 2021. In principle, only for Android devices. The following year it also began to offer this option to users of Apple devices.
But, since this service has not been widely publicized, many subscribers are unaware that they have access to a ton of high-quality mobile games. And free (that is, you don't have to pay anything extra, since this is included in the subscription). The best thing is that they are not limited in any way and are offered completely free of advertising.
Where to find games on Netflix for iPhone
Curiously, the main problem for the user is finding these games on the platform, since it is relatively easy for them to go unnoticed within the application. Again, this apparent lack of interest in promoting games on Netflix's part is something really difficult to understand.
In any case, the games are available as free downloads to any subscriber. Of course, first we have to install the Netflix application on our iPhone or iPad. This is the download link in the Apple Store.
The games alone They remain active as long as we are Netflix subscribers. This is done to prevent someone from getting the idea of subscribing for a month, loading their device with all the free games, and then canceling their subscription.
Accessing games on Netflix for iPhone is very simple. The real difficulty is know which of them are original and which are versions for the platform. The way to find out is this: Open the Netflix application on our iPhone and look for the section titled "Mobile Games." Selecting one displays a small notification at the bottom of the phone to be installed directly on the phone.
And to play, nothing could be easier: go to the application, search for the game and click on it. All comfortably from our iPhone.

Football Manager 2024
We open the selection of games on Netflix for iPhone with a title highly appreciated by those who long for the golden age of soccer team management games. Those that caused a sensation in the 90s. Football Manager 2024 It preserves the "retro" aesthetics and spirit of these games, but with a more complete interface and many improvements.
Don't be fooled by its rudimentary graphics (they are designed that way on purpose), because It has a high level of playability, which requires the user to control a multitude of variants to achieve success: find the right tactics, make the necessary signings... And, above all, train a lot.
Game Dev Tycoon

This title has only recently appeared on the list of Netflix games, but it already has a significant number of followers. Game Dev Tycoon (which can be translated as "game development magnate") puts us in the role of a young geek in his fight for create a successful game from the garage of your house. The topic.
Fortunately, you don't have to write code or anything like that. The player's mission is to choose the theme and genre of their game, as well as the name of the platform for which we are creating it. And that's it. As in real life, once the game goes on sale you have to expose yourself to public opinion. And pray that sales are good.

Reigns: Three Kingdoms

An interesting title for our list of games on Netflix for iPhone: Reigns: Three Kingdoms. A text-based adventure in which we must decide what to do in each scene, just by swiping left or right to choose a different path.
The argument is the struggle for power in the Chinese empire during the Han dynasty. To be successful it is necessary for the player to use his weapons and resources well. Sometimes there is no choice but to go to war, but other times it is much more convenient to use diplomacy.
World of Goo

We close our small list of games on Netflix for iPhones with a classic of touch screens: World Of Goo. The renewed version presented on Netflix retains all the charm of the original game.
The player must connect drops of a viscous substance in order to build bridges, towers and other constructions that help us move from one level to the next. The mechanics are apparently simple, but the game has its tricks. Sometimes, we get stuck at a level where it seems impossible to advance. But no: you have to persevere, no matter how many hours and mental efforts it entails.
